Consultant
So the interview process started with like two HR screening calls, mainly to see if I fit and if my communication skills were up to par, and if I was aligned with the company culture and values. It was a good chance for me to talk about my experience and why I wanted the job, and also to make sure we were on the same page about what the role involved. After that, they sent me a take-home case study. It was meant to check my problem-solving, analytical skills, and how I think things through, especially with a deadline. I put together a detailed report with my approach, what I assumed, and what I recommended. The last part was a Q&A with a senior manager where I had to present my case findings and answer their more in-depth questions. This part really tested how quickly I could think, justify my ideas, and show that I have good business sense on the spot. Pretty soon after finishing all that, I got the offer.

Consultant
First up is a phone interview. Hiring depends on demand. If a new client comes in, HR will review candidates they've already spoken with on the phone or met at job fairs and invite them for an in-person interview. The phone interview is pretty basic, so don't stress about it. The in-person interview has some challenging questions. Be straight with the HR director and don't try to trick them; they'll figure it out. Also, dress appropriately. Many of our clients have a blue-collar workforce, and they appreciate our modest approach, not being flashy or arrogant. If you're thinking of a flashy suit, this probably isn't the right fit unless you have hospitality experience.
